Skip to main content

JavaScript Developer -Python

Technology
AgileGrid Solutions
Oberlin, United StatesYesterdayUntil 7/19/2026
Fully remote

Job description

About The Company Crossing Hurdles is a forward-thinking technology company dedicated to pushing the boundaries of artificial intelligence and software development. Our mission is to develop innovative solutions that address complex challenges across various industries. With a team of highly skilled professionals and a collaborative work environment, Crossing Hurdles strives to deliver impactful products that drive technological advancement and improve user experiences worldwide.

We value creativity, agility, and a commitment to excellence, fostering a culture where talent and innovation thrive.

About The Role We are seeking a highly skilled Software Engineer (SWE) with expertise in Python, JavaScript, Typescript, and C++ to join our dynamic team on a remote, hourly contract basis. This role offers an exciting opportunity to collaborate with top AI researchers from leading AI laboratories on cutting-edge projects. As a key contributor, you will be responsible for developing, debugging, and optimizing complex software systems that support our AI initiatives.

The position is designed for professionals who are passionate about software engineering, eager to work on innovative solutions, and capable of managing multiple tasks within a fast-paced environment.

Qualifications The ideal candidate will possess strong experience in one or more of the relevant programming languages, including Python, JavaScript, Typescript, and C++. A high level of attention to detail, combined with exceptional written and verbal communication skills, is essential for success in this role. Candidates should demonstrate a solid understanding of software development best practices, including writing clean, efficient, and maintainable code, as well as experience with testing and debugging.

Prior experience working in AI or machine learning projects is a plus, along with the ability to collaborate effectively in an asynchronous team environment.

Responsibilities Collaborate with top AI researchers from leading AI labs to work on advanced software engineering tasks, contributing to the development of innovative AI solutions.

Debug and refactor existing codebases to enhance performance, security, and maintainability, ensuring robust and scalable software systems.

Write comprehensive test cases to validate code functionality, identify potential issues early, and improve overall code quality.

Work asynchronously with the project manager and development team to meet project deadlines, coordinate efforts, and ensure seamless integration of new features.

Participate in code reviews, documentation, and knowledge sharing to foster continuous improvement within the team.

Benefits This contract role provides flexible remote working arrangements, allowing you to work from anywhere.

Compensation is competitive, ranging from $50 to $60 per hour, based on experience and expertise. The project duration is approximately 2 to 4 weeks, with a commitment of 10 to 40 hours per week, offering you the flexibility to balance other commitments. You will have the opportunity to work on innovative AI projects, collaborate with industry-leading researchers, and enhance your skills in a stimulating environment.

Additionally, you will gain valuable experience in a fast-paced, technology-driven organization that values professional growth and development.

Equal Opportunity Crossing Hurdles is committed to creating an inclusive environment for all employees and applicants. We are an equal opportunity employer, and we do not discriminate based on race, color, religion, gender, sexual orientation, gender identity, national origin, age, disability, or any other protected characteristic. We believe diversity fosters innovation and drives our success, and we welcome candidates from all backgrounds to apply for this exciting opportunity.

Keywords
PythonJavaScriptTypescriptC++Software DevelopmentDebuggingTestingCode ReviewCollaborationAIMachine LearningAsynchronous CommunicationClean CodePerformance OptimizationSecurityMaintainabilitySoftware EngineeringRemote Work

Interested in this role?